Leaves
Watch as the leaf floats to the ground Hitting the earth without making a sound Though it is only one of a forest so vast It's beauty is something that can't be surpassed Each inch holds a whole world within Volumes of knowledge in something so thin Its edges curled, its surface tinted red An entire universe sits upon the forest’s bed
